[Impact]
Fixes issues using whois with .hr/.sx/.pe TLDs. In addition updates query 
format for IPs when accessing ARIN.

[Development Fix]
These issues were fixed in 5.0.14 of whois.

[Stable Fix]
Since most of the fixes are covered in updating from 5.0.11 to 5.0.14, a 
backport of these version provides all fixes.

[Test Case]
1) whois google.hr (works on precise, not on oneiric)
2) whois registry.sx google.com.pe
3) whois 74.125.113.102
   if we use this command in precise we see that whois adds "n +" to the query, 
while
   in oneiric it doesn't add that.

[Regression Potential]
Most of the changes are fairly minimal, although any changes to mkpasswd should 
be investigated.

Problem Description:
whois in oneiric can't query .hr/.sx/.pe TLDs. In addition the query format for 
ARIN is different than in precise.

Version affected:
Current Oneiric Version: 5.0.11ubuntu2
